Noun

  1. Any plant in the genus Lagophylla- annual flowers of the western US having leaves covered by dense, soft hairs reminiscent of a rabbit's fur.

Origin

From the name of the genus, which is from Ancient Greek λαγώς (lagṓs, “hare”) + φύλλον (phúllon, “leaf”).
